Company Overview

Snapshot

Founded in March 2011 by Perry Davidson, Syqe Medical operates with 51–200 employees. The company has raised $72.65 million across 3 funding rounds from 7 investors. In November 2023, its SyqeAir Inhaler obtained ARTG Approval in Australia, marking a significant milestone in medicinal cannabis treatment.

Business overview

Syqe Medical is a MedTech company specializing in a breakthrough technology for medical cannabis administration. Its core product, the SyqeAir Inhaler, is a unique platform designed to enable physicians and patients to manage cannabis treatment safely and effectively. The device ensures metered dosing, lowest effective dose, and safety of use, delivering a consistent and personalized amount of THC from raw medical cannabis inflorescence with each inhalation. The company serves the healthcare industry, focusing on patients seeking pain reduction and improved sleep quality, operating within the Health Tech & Life Sciences sector, specifically Medical Cannabis and Medical Devices.

Strategic signal

In July 2025, Syqe Medical announced structural adjustments, primarily in its development department, including job cuts. This move is aimed at focusing resources on securing US FDA clearance, following a 2023 deal to be acquired by Philip Morris pending this approval. This indicates a strategic pivot towards regulatory approval in a key market, signaling a critical phase in the company's trajectory and potential for future market expansion.

Which company is reportedly acquiring Syqe Medical?
In July 2023, Philip Morris was reported to be acquiring Cannabis inhaler developer Syqe Medical for up to $650 million, pending FDA approval.
When did Syqe Medical enter into a distribution agreement with TerrAscend for the Canadian market?
In September 2019, Syqe Medical entered into a distribution agreement with TerrAscend to bring its medical cannabis treatment to Canada.
